Definition

  1. 1
    Nouveau métal découvert en 1844 par Heinrich Rose dans la tantalite de Bavière, ainsi que le niobium. Assigné à la place maintenant occupée par le technétium, le pélopium s’avéra n’avoir été que du niobium impur. Son symbole était Pe ou Pl.
